What will I learn?

The Doctor of Philosophy degree in Environmental Engineering offered by the Department of Environmental Engineering at Texas A&M University-Kingsville prepares students for careers in research, teaching and environmental management. As environmental issues transcend media and geographic borders, it is increasingly important for the environmental professional to be able to address issues and derive solutions from a holistic basis. Students enrolled in the program are exposed to the fundamental principles, tools and applications in Environmental Systems Engineering spanning eight areas:Air Quality,Water Quality,Solid/Hazardous Waste,Ecological Engineering,Natural Resources Management,Environmental Systems,Environmental Informatics andEnvironmental Biotechnology.Coursework RequirementsA total of 63 credits to meet the graduation requirementsA total of 6 credits of required didactic courses: 1) Advanced Engineering Math, and 2) Seminar and Research Integrity, which are 3 credits eachA minimum 18 credits of didactic 6xxx coursework, which includes the above 6 creditsA minimum 30 credits of dissertation

Entry requirements

For international students

Students must hold a minimum of a baccalaureate degree and an acceptable combination of GRE scores. The minimum score required is a 6.0 overall band score. Test of English as a Foreign Language (TOEFL) score of 79 (Internet-based) or 550(Paper-based) is the university minimum requirement for all Graduate students.
